It costs to rewash

Plates, glasses and cutlery (silverware) often come out of the wash with soils. This leads to high rewash rates that cost valuable time, money and energy. In fact, a recent Ecolab study showed that only 35% of tested wares were adequately cleaned on the first wash cycle. A whopping 47% required hand polishing, while 19% needed an entire rewash. With innovative enzymes, you can break down and remove food soils on the first wash. No need to rewash.

Benefits of enzymatic warewashing

  • Removes tough food soils
  • Eliminates residual protein and starch films
  • Saves energy by allowing for lower temperature wash cycles
  • Lowers pH of wastewater discharged to your grease trap and/or interceptor
  • Gentle on equipment 
  • Provide a safer, more sustainable clean
